PRESS RELEASE



 

I am contacting you as a representative of LASFS, the Los Angeles Science Fantasy Society.  I would like to submit information on our annual convention, LOSCON 29, for inclusion in your events calendar for the month of November.

The pertinent info is:

LosCon 29
November 29th - December 1, 2002
Burbank Airport Hilton and Convention Center
2500 Hollywood Way
Burbank, California 91505

Guests of Honor include:
David Weber (Writer)
Nene Thomas (Artist)
Patty Wells (Fan)

Key Events include:
Science, Literature and Media Programming
Ice Cream Social, Lux After Dark Nightclub and Rock Dance
Film and Anime Viewing Rooms and Audio Listening Lounge

Current Weekend Membership Rates:
$40.00 through October 31st
$45.00 at the door

For more information, visit http://www.loscon.org/loscon/29/

For your general information, here is some background on our convention:

Loscon enjoys an attendance of 1300-plus members from around the globe, and is a well-established gathering point for people interested in science fiction and fantasy.  Attendees and speakers include authors, artists, scientists, educators, and film and media professionals, who participate in programming items including lectures, panels and round table discussions in a broad range of fields.  Topics range from the latest developments at NASA and JPL to breakthroughs in physics, astronomy and biotechnology, and speculation about the future or fantasy worlds featured in popular works ranging from comics to literature to film and television.  To balance the academic nature of our programming, evening events are more social in nature; Regency-period recreation and Rock-and-Roll dances, gala live theater productions, an Ice Cream Social and a Masquerade all help to promote fellowship among the convention members.  We offer a separate track of children's programming, with panels and activities tailored to their education and interests.   The convention also strives to provide service and support to the community by hosting drives for causes such as Locks of Love (which provides real-hair hairpieces for children undergoing chemotherapy/radiation), a Blood Drive for the American Red Cross, and a Toy Drive to provide gifts for underprivileged children during the holiday season.

The Los Angeles Science Fantasy Society (LASFS) is the oldest continuously meeting science-fiction club in this world, founded October 27, 1934.  The society is chartered as a non-profit educational and literary institution, and houses a circulating library of over 53,000 volumes of science fiction and fantasy - the largest privately held collection of its kind in the world.  LASFS counts among its past and current membership such literary luminaries as: Forrest J. Ackerman, Ray Bradbury, Ray Harryhausen, Robert Heinlein, Henry Kuttner, Jack Williamson, Robert Bloch, Larry Niven, Jerry Pournelle and Steven Barnes.
